Страница 2 из 5
Re: BMP085+Сервер под Linux
Добавлено: Вс июл 14, 2013 7:21 pm
Geban
А нужно смотреть на схему программатора. Но с вероятностью 80% можно сделать из него, поправив в исходниках дефайны на ноги. USBasp собран на меге8. А что касательно меги 328.. на вероятно нужно будет в мейк файле поправить тип кристалла и исправить обращение к регистрам переферии конроллера.. вобщем переделок не должно быть очень много..
Re: BMP085+Сервер под Linux
Добавлено: Пн июл 15, 2013 7:27 am
MaksMS82
Geban писал(а):А нужно смотреть на схему программатора. Но с вероятностью 80% можно сделать из него, поправив в исходниках дефайны на ноги. USBasp собран на меге8. А что касательно меги 328.. на вероятно нужно будет в мейк файле поправить тип кристалла и исправить обращение к регистрам переферии конроллера.. вобщем переделок не должно быть очень много..
Как раз жду такой программатор,сравню схему с PROTOSS 910 как придет..Стоимость-то его очень привлекательна.
мега 8 и мега 328 так-то схожи,разница вроде как только в объеме памяти,возможно попробую сделать такое,как найду кварц на 12мгц
Re: BMP085+Сервер под Linux
Добавлено: Пн июл 15, 2013 10:17 am
Geban
Вся прелесть такого решения в том что оно не привязано к конкретному сенсору. Можно подключить любое устройство I2C нужно только написать под него прослойку между I2C и пользователем
Re: BMP085+Сервер под Linux
Добавлено: Пн июл 15, 2013 12:29 pm
MaksMS82
Geban писал(а):Вся прелесть такого решения в том что оно не привязано к конкретному сенсору. Можно подключить любое устройство I2C нужно только написать под него прослойку между I2C и пользователем
Да как раз исходников полно для малинки,которые тут подойдут как раз..
Re: BMP085+Сервер под Linux
Добавлено: Вт июл 16, 2013 7:51 am
MaksMS82
И так,вчера пришел программатор USBasp USBISP 3.3V / 5V AVR Programmer USB ATMEGA8 .
Вот схема
http://homes-smart.ru/upload/arduino/US ... matics.pdf
Схема конечно отличается от PROTTOSS ,но под USB-I2C наверно можно переделать,стоимость в 100 руб привлекает ..
Основную функцию как программатор выполняет,но на ATtiny85 выдает не фатальную ошибку.
Хотел обновить прошивку и столкнулся с проблемой - не шьется вообще ,ошибка Device signature = 0x000000 avrdude: Yikes! Invalid device signature.Возможно м/к заблокирован..Очень жаль.
Re: BMP085+Сервер под Linux
Добавлено: Вт июл 16, 2013 10:20 am
Geban
там есть перемычка на платке.. её замкнуть надо. она подтягивает reset меги на разъем программирования. Ну судя по схеме должно работать. только надо будет в коде поменять дефайны пинов и откомпилитью
А вообще.. ЛУТом платка делается за 20 мин.. а программатор пригодится. имхо )
Re: BMP085+Сервер под Linux
Добавлено: Вт июл 16, 2013 11:18 am
MaksMS82
Geban писал(а):там есть перемычка на платке.. её замкнуть надо. она подтягивает reset меги на разъем программирования. Ну судя по схеме должно работать. только надо будет в коде поменять дефайны пинов и откомпилитью
А вообще.. ЛУТом платка делается за 20 мин.. а программатор пригодится. имхо )
Про reset в курсе )) хотя в англоязычной инструкции про её ни слова..
Для травления платы вообще ничего не имеется,да и м/к меги8 нет.А программатор ещё один заказан за 3 бакса для таких экспериментов.
Re: BMP085+Сервер под Linux
Добавлено: Ср июл 17, 2013 4:46 pm
viris
Re: BMP085+Сервер под Linux
Добавлено: Ср июл 17, 2013 6:43 pm
Geban
Так это ж тоже самое вроди бы
Re: BMP085+Сервер под Linux
Добавлено: Ср июл 17, 2013 9:06 pm
MaksMS82
Сейчас попробовал прошить AVR Programmer в I2C-tiny наобум.. Ничего не вышло,надеялся увидеть устройство в системе..
Вроде УСБ выводы соответствуют из примера схемы на атмеге8,но возможно в оригинальных исходниках они не те заданы.Буду копать исходники ещё завтра
А так пока прошил его новой прошивкой по прямому назначению - пропали ошибки при прошивке тиньки85